Pentanedial (glutaraldehyde) is treated with excess HCN, followed by complete acidic hydrolysis. The stereochemical composition of the final product mixture is:
Options
- AOne meso compound and a pair of enantiomers
- BTwo optically active diastereomers
- COnly a racemic mixture
- DTwo meso compounds
Correct answer
A. One meso compound and a pair of enantiomers
Step-by-step solution
Pentanedial is an achiral dialdehyde with the structure OHC-CH ₂ -CH ₂ -CH ₂ -CHO . Step (i): Reaction with excess HCN leads to nucleophilic addition at both aldehyde groups, forming a bis-cyanohydrin. Step (ii): Complete acidic hydrolysis converts both -CN groups to -COOH groups, yielding 2,6-dihydroxyheptanedioic acid, HOOC-CH(OH)-CH ₂ -CH ₂ -CH ₂ -CH(OH)-COOH .
